Karma Kitchen Chicago Opens With a Baam!

After approximately 1 year of planning, preparing, and putting forth full efforts to bring Karma Kitchen to the great city of Chicago, the time has finally come!  On Sunday, July 11, 2010, Karma Kitchen Chicago opened its doors in collaboration with Klay Oven Restaurant located in the River North area of the Windy City. ...

Year of Giving

I really like what Karma Kitchen is trying to accomplish and frequent the Washington DC location. Last time I was there they gave me $10 to pay it forward some how... I chose to pass the money onto a DC classroom project at Donars Choose (www.donarschoose.org). I passed the money onto a teacher who asked for pencils for her students. I seemed crazy to me that they did not even have enough pencils!!! 

Thanks Karma Kitchen for showing me how small gifts can make such an impact.

Karma Kitchen DC Community Profiles!

The Karma Kitchen DC Team has decided to embark on a new project!

Every Sunday we meet amazing individuals who inspire us, question us, and basically make the Karma Kitchen experience unique and wonderful. We thought it was about time we told the world about these incredible people which include guests, volunteers, and maybe even the random person who walks by Karma Kitchen.

In the first Community Profile, meet John Chambers, founder of BloomBars community art space, a regular guest, and fierce advocate of Karma Kitchen.
